1. An apparatus for operating on tissue, the apparatus comprising:
(a) a shaft, wherein the shaft defines a longitudinal axis;
(b) an acoustic waveguide, wherein the acoustic waveguide comprises a flexible portion;
(c) an articulation section coupled with the shaft, wherein the articulation section is configured to transition between a non-articulated configuration and an articulated configuration, wherein a portion of the articulation section encompasses the flexible portion of the acoustic waveguide;
(d) an end effector comprising an ultrasonic blade in acoustic communication with the acoustic waveguide, wherein the articulation section is configured to deflect the ultrasonic blade relative to the longitudinal axis of the shaft in the articulation configuration; and
(e) a rigidizing member housing the portion of the articulation section, wherein the rigidizing member comprises a rotating sheath configured to rotate relative to the portion of the articulation section between a first position and a second position while the articulation section is in the non-articulated configuration, wherein the rigidizing member is configured to selectively provide rigidity to the articulation section in the first position via direct engagement between the rotating sheath of the rigidizing member and the portion of the articulating section encompassing the flexible portion of the acoustic waveguide, wherein the rigidizing member is configured to allow the articulation section to transition between the non-articulated configuration and the articulated configuration in the second position.
